    ADB PLC now solid & robust …profit continue to soar

    The Agricultural Development Bank (ADB) PLC under the leadership of its Managing Director, Alhassan Yakubu-Tali has recorded sterling results for the bank for the first nine months of 2024.

    According to the Bank’s published financial figures for the first nine months of 2024, the bank recorded impressive profit before tax of GHC176.414 million compared with GHC26.999 million recorded during the same period in 2023, representing a profit growth of over 600 percent.

    Profit after tax stood at GHC111.827million for the period under review compared with a profit after tax of GHC2.040million recorded during the same period last year. percent.

    The liquidity ratio of the Bank also grew from 91.94% in 2023 to 125.55% as at end of September, 2024, and deposits have also witnessed significant growth from GHC7.75 billion to GHC11.15 billion.

    This remarkable record could be attributed to hard work and commitment on the part of Board, Management and Staff to make the bank more robust and also to maintain its position as one of the market leaders in the banking industry.

    The Agriculture Development Bank which operates with a universal banking license that allows it to undertake all banking and related services embarked on an aggressive recoveries of the non-performing loans in an effort to clean it books.

    With the new capital and improved recoveries, the bank expects to exceed the Capital Adequacy Ratio (CAR) and the unimpaired regulatory capital position by the year end 2024.

    ADB PLC recently received several 5-Star ratings at the Chartered Institute of Marketing Ghana (CIMG) Customer Satisfaction Survey Index Report Launch and Awards Night.

    The recognition is a direct consequence of the development and implementation of a customer care and service quality strategic pillar as part of a two-year corporate strategy introduced by the Bank in 2023.

    The bank garnered5-Star Ratings in: Customer Satisfaction – Consumer Banking; Customer Satisfaction – Business Banking; Service Quality – Consumer Banking; and Service Quality -Business Banking. The Bank was also adjudged the First Runner-Up position in Business Banking Service Quality.

    With an increasing investment in digital banking and service efficiency, ADB continues to be among the leading banks, setting benchmarks for innovation and excellence in Ghana’s banking industry.

    As customer expectations rise, ADB’s ability to adapt and improve makes it a trusted and reliable choice for both individual and business clients alike.
